Transaction 38255383446c73f6f73808ed40c6efb7303cc7fc13fb5e1cf6d819acc7741bdb
1 Input
1 Output
-
38255383446c73f6f73808ed40c6efb7303cc7fc13fb5e1cf6d819acc7741bdb:0
- value
- 1393765
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43b9d7a9e94d5a75a646deb1f495e602d6094e08 OP_EQUAL
- address
- 37s7pxMhNWDQy2giywBb5CwfopgwPh8Rv8